Chef Satoshi Ogura served our omakase and it was mind blowingly amazing. He took the time to explain what each piece was and even showed photos of the fish in a book. But beyond the 5 star food, the SERVICE was 10 stars. At the end of the meal Chef Ogura walked us out to the front door and politely agreed to take some photos with us. He noticed it was raining and asked if we needed a taxi. We said yes thinking he would just help us call a taxi, but he literally ran out into the rain and disappeared for a few minutes before finally returning with a taxi. Unbelievable to experience and hard to believe any other chef would have done that for 2 ordinary customers. Definitely a top 3 all time sushi experience.

Extension sushi, the restaurant is very particular about the handling of seafood. Master Sushi can communicate in English, and he will also come up with seafood encyclopedia books about the fish served on the day. Before meals, Sushi Master will also ask guests about their preferences for various types of fish. Unlike other sushi restaurants, they are generally not flexible.The meal also serves many kinds of sake, and it is really an impeccable restaurant.The atmosphere is quite relaxed, and guests will not be rushed because of the long business hours.
